USB Rechargeable Pivoting LED Flood Light - 550 Lumens
The MILWAUKEE REDLITHIUM USB ROVER Pivoting Flood Light offers best in class output in any direction and is powered by REDLITHIUM USB. The compact LED floodlight offers 550 lumens of TRUEVIEW High Definition Output. The light head has 210° of rotation, to direct high output light to any work surface.

A wide, magnetic base allows for positioning the pivoting floodlight on common work surfaces or mounting it to metal for hands free task lighting. Its collapsible design fits into pockets and a built in carabiner provides the ability to clip it to tool organizers or straps for easy transport. The three different output modes allow professionals to optimize their light output and runtime for up to 13 hours of runtime. The REDLITHIUM USB ROVER Pivoting Flood Light Light is powered by the REDLITHIUM USB 3.0AH Battery, providing all day run time, more recharges, and 3x faster charge time. The Milwaukee REDLITHIUM USB Battery can be recharged in the flashlight via Micro USB or swapped out with additional REDLITHIUM USB Batteries for virtually no downtime.
• 2 ft. jobsite tough, braided micro-USB cable with metal ends
• 3X faster charge time delivers 80% charge in under 1 hour (using 2.1 A compatible wall plug)
• Built-in carabiner clips to tool bags for transporting on and off site
• Folds up compact for easy storage in a pocket
• Fuel gauge allows fast checking of REDLITHIUM USB battery charge
• IP54 Rated: Water and Dust Resistant
• Three light output modes: High mode: 550 lumens- 2.0 hours; Medium mode: 250 lumens- 4.5 hours; Low mode: 100 lumens- 11.5 hours
